Hearing voices is common in schizophrenia patients. This type of false sensory perception is called an auditory hallucination. A hallucination is a perception of something that is not there or does not exist. There are many types of hallucinations and the most common hallucination experienced by schizophrenia patients is auditory hallucinations.
